Sobre a configuração do Monitor
Os usos para as funções de configuração do monitor incluem:
- Calibragem de cores. Um monitor calibrado corretamente reproduz as cores corretamente. Normalmente, um aplicativo de calibragem de cores exibe um padrão de teste e tem controles para alterar uma configuração de monitor. O usuário altera a configuração até que uma condição seja atendida e repete esse processo para cada configuração de monitor até que o monitor seja calibrado.
- Ajustando a área de exibição do monitor. As funções de configuração do monitor podem ser usadas para alterar o tamanho e a posição da área de exibição de um monitor. Por exemplo, quando um monitor LCD é conectado a um computador usando um conector analógico, a melhor qualidade da imagem é obtida quando há um mapeamento um-para-um entre pixels no buffer de quadros do cartão gráfico e pixels no monitor LCD.
- Salvando e restaurando as configurações do monitor. Alguns usuários precisam de vários conjuntos de configurações de monitor, pois cenários diferentes exigem configurações de monitor diferentes. Por exemplo, as configurações de monitor ideais para aplicativos da área de trabalho não são ideais para assistir televisão.
- Usando recursos de monitor específicos do fornecedor. Usando as funções de configuração do monitor, os fabricantes podem criar aplicativos que usam os recursos específicos do fornecedor do monitor.
As funções de configuração do monitor são divididas em funções de alto nível e de baixo nível. As funções de alto nível são mais fáceis de usar do que as funções de baixo nível. Para usar as funções de alto nível, você não precisa saber nada sobre a Interface de Comando do Canal de Dados de Exibição (DDC/CI). No entanto, as funções de alto nível não dão acesso a recursos específicos do fornecedor do monitor.
As funções de baixo nível são um wrapper fino em torno dos comandos DDC/CI. Para usar as funções de baixo nível, você deve estar familiarizado com o padrão DDC/CI e também com o padrão MCCS (Conjunto de Comandos de Controle de Monitor) VESA. Em geral, você deve usar as funções de alto nível, a menos que precise usar recursos disponíveis apenas nas funções de baixo nível.
As funções de configuração de monitor de alto nível são projetadas para que um aplicativo não possa colocar um monitor em um estado inutilizável. As funções de baixo nível podem ser usadas para enviar códigos VCP para o monitor. No entanto, lembre-se de que alguns códigos VCP podem desabilitar funcionalidades importantes ou colocar o monitor em um estado em que o usuário não possa ver a imagem de exibição. Para obter mais informações, consulte o padrão DO MCCS (Conjunto de Comandos de Controle do Monitor vesa).
Tópicos relacionados